Inclusive jet production as a probe of polarized PDFs at a future EIC

Abstract

We present a detailed phenomenological study of polarized inclusive jet production in electron-proton collisions at a future Electron-Ion Collider (EIC). Our analysis is performed at next-to-leading order in perturbative QCD using the numerical code DISTRESS and includes all relevant partonic channels and resolved photon contributions. We elucidate the role of different kinematic regions in probing different aspects of proton and photon structure and study the impact of the EIC collision energy on the measurement of polarized parton distribution functions.
